High school and college career

Robinson was a stand-out scorer for St. Mary's High School, averaging 35.8 points a game as a senior en route to Player of the Year and Offensive Player of the Year (by the Archdiocesan Athletic Association Large Division) honors.[1]

Mostly coming off the bench, he averaged 9.9 points per contest in his freshman year (2014–15) at Austin Peay. He increased his scoring output as a sophomore, pouring in 16.9 points a game for the Governors, making 72 triples on the season, while pulling down 3.1 rebounds and handing out 2.6 assists per outing. As a junior, Robinson scored 20.3 points per game, having converted 71-of-194 from beyond the arc. He also averaged 3.5 assists and 3.0 rebounds per contest.[2] In early March 2017, Robinson was arrested on drug charges[3] and subsequently suspended indefinitely by Austin Peay for a violation of team rules.[4]

Robinson opted to enter the 2017 NBA draft as an underclassman,[5] but was not taken by any team.[6]
